    Description

    Job Summary:

    Provides genetic counseling and referral services for patients of all age groups (including obstetric-prenatal counseling, multiple miscarriage counseling, reproductive screening and advice, newborn consultation and cancer patients) who have or are at risk for genetic conditions or birth defects. Acts as a consultant to health care providers regarding highly specialized genetic information pertinent to management of their patients.

    Essential Responsibilities:

    • Upholds Kaiser Permanentes Policies and Procedures, Principles of Responsibilities and applicable state, federal and local laws.
    • Provides genetic counseling services for all areas of medical genetics including pediatric, prenatal, adult, and cancer referrals.
    • Reviews patient chart and evaluates family history through investigation of outside records, examination of affected individuals, or family testing of chromosome analysis, DNA studies, metabolic screening, etc.
    • Assesses recurrence risk and recommends medical or genetic testing based on analysis of the risk, benefit and cost.
    • Provides crisis intervention and psychosocial counseling to members upon discovery of unexpected findings (e.g., malformation, biochemical disorders) regarding genetic conditions.
    • Reviews implications and discusses options with member and/or family members. Makes referrals for ongoing care and support.
    • Provides case management for complex genetic cases including coordination medical recommendations and management plans, testing and ongoing counseling.
    • Develops, implements and coordinates a wide variety of genetic programs (e.g., prenatal diagnosis, California Prenatal Screening Program, carrier screening and specialty clinics). Follows guidelines mandated by the State of California.
    • Produces culturally sensitive and age appropriate patient and health professional educational materials, and participates in community education programs.
    • Conducts literature search on rare genetic diseases and keeps abreast of developments in the field.
    • Develops and presents in-service education to physicians and health professional education materials, and current medical genetic topics.
    • Maintains statistics, survey trends, and adjusts protocols to ensure appropriate patient referral and care.
    • Recommends and implements enhanced clinical practice standards.
    • Participates in research projects.
    • Participates in group quality assurance case conferences with the Medical Geneticist.
    • Reviews complex family pedigrees, unusual cases, abnormal AFP results, viewing of photographs, DNA studies, etc.
